(CHICAGO) Cubs fans taking the Red Line to the game could board a piece of Chicago rail history.
The CTA will operate what it is calling its “World Series Special” for the games played here in Chicago.
The 2400-series trains built in the late 1970s, are decked out in Red, White and Blue and have been decorated with Cubs posters.
The train is apart of CTA’s Heritage Fleet, a program to preserve historic rail cars and buses.
The train is set to depart Friday from Howard making a run to 95th at around 3:45pm. The return trip departs 95th at around 4:50pm. The CTA says times are approximate and subject to change.
Aside from the “World Series Special,” the CTA is also providing extra rail and bus service for the games.
